當無法遠程連接MySQL數據庫時,可能有以下幾個原因和解決方法:
sudo ufw allow 3306
bind-address
注釋掉或者修改為服務器的IP地址,然后重啟MySQL服務:sudo systemctl restart mysql
GRANT ALL PRIVILEGES ON *.* TO 'username'@'%' IDENTIFIED BY 'password' WITH GRANT OPTION;
FLUSH PRIVILEGES;
其中,'username’是遠程連接的用戶名,'password’是密碼。%表示允許從任意IP地址連接,如果只允許特定IP地址連接,可以將%替換為特定IP地址。
telnet IP地址 3306
如果無法連接,可能需要檢查網絡配置或聯系網絡管理員。
注意:在進行遠程連接時,請確保數據庫的用戶名和密碼是正確的,并且服務器的IP地址和端口號是正確的。